From 9134ab39f5577ec942ee0d41cace82676fde2728 Mon Sep 17 00:00:00 2001 From: Kia <kia@special-circumstanc.es> Date: Sun, 8 Nov 2020 19:45:51 -0700 Subject: [PATCH] an off by one. again. --- bison_xml_file_ingest.py | 8 +++----- 1 file changed, 3 insertions(+), 5 deletions(-) diff --git a/bison_xml_file_ingest.py b/bison_xml_file_ingest.py index 915ed3d..57d6883 100644 --- a/bison_xml_file_ingest.py +++ b/bison_xml_file_ingest.py @@ -474,12 +474,10 @@ for state_number, reduce_rule_number in reduce_rule_locations: assert(fromgraph[0] == state_number) stack_state = fromgraph[1] - print(stack_state) - rule_RHS = rules[reduce_rule_number - 1][1][::-1] - + print("state number is", state_number, "stack_state is", stack_state) + rule_RHS = rules[reduce_rule_number][1][::-1] + print("rule number is", reduce_rule_number, "and its RHS is",rule_RHS) for idx, x in enumerate(rule_RHS): - print("rule number", idx, "with rhs equal to", x) - print("stack_state[",idx,"]=",stack_state[idx]) assert(stack_state[idx] == x) -- GitLab